San Carlos
was founded by Fr. Francisco dela Rama May 23, 1587 and first
named Binalatongan, referring iin the local dialect to the abundance
of Mongo beans in the town. In 1666, the Malong revolt headed
by Andres Malong erupted during which the whole town was destroyed.
However, as the visitor can see for himself it was since rebuilt.
